Folks at River Hill High School want to keep students, staff and the community healthy through the cold and flu season. In addition to monthly citrus sales, the RHHS-PTSA will host a flu vaccination clinic in the Student Dining Center on Wednesday, Nov. 12 from 2:30-8:30 p.m.
Each vaccination will cost $30. Medicaid and Medicare will be accepted. Appointments are recommended, but walk-ins are welcome on a first-come, first-serve basis. Part of the cost will go to support the PTSA. For further information, go to www.pta.org/flushotclinic, scroll to the bottom and click Schedule an Appointment or call 1-866-782-3014.
